Christopher J.
Kovski
is the founder of New Blossoms New Life Foundation, established in 2007, where he holds the title of Vice President.
He also held various former positions, including Director-Employee Relations at Blair Corp.
from 2006 to 2007, Director-Human Resources at Pittsburgh Glass Works LLC in 2009, Principal at Erie Indemnity Co. in 2008, and Partner at Elderkin, Martin, Kelly & Messina PC from 1995 to 2006.
He also served as Chief Human Resources Officer at Celtic Healthcare, Inc. and Vice President-Human Resources at UPMC Hamot in 2009.
Mr. Kovski's education history includes an undergraduate degree from Mercyhurst University and graduate degrees from Arizona State University and The Ohio University.
